Different Welding Certificates
Although the American Welding Society’s basic Certified Welder credential helps make you eligible for almost all jobs, many fields demand a certain certificate. Some of the most-well-known of which are highlighted below.
- ASME Certification for individuals that work with boiler and pressure containers
- Certified Welder Certificates to be a Certified Welder
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for those who work on pipelines in the energy field
- SCWI and CWI Certificates for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

This table shows wages and jobs estimates for welders in the State of Georgia through the end of the decade.
| Georgia |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 7,750 | 9,200 | 19% | 340 |
| Georgia |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$22,300 | $33,800 | $48,700 |
Source: O*Net Online
